The closely bunched implied probabilities around 44-45.5% for the 2026 Italian Grand Prix constructor pole reflect deep uncertainty ahead of Monza's high-speed layout. Major regulatory shifts—including lighter chassis, active aerodynamics, a 50/50 electric-combustion power split, and an overtake mode replacing traditional DRS—have produced more evenly matched cars than in prior seasons, as confirmed during Bahrain pre-season testing where Ferrari posted strong pace but Mercedes demonstrated reliability advantages. Mid-season standings show Mercedes leading the constructors' championship ahead of Ferrari and McLaren, yet no team has established consistent qualifying dominance on power-sensitive circuits. New power unit suppliers (Audi, Ford/Red Bull) add further variables, while the arrival of Cadillac keeps the field unpredictable. These dynamics sustain tight trader consensus without a clear favorite.

If the 2026 F1 Italian Grand Prix is canceled or rescheduled to a date after Sep 12, 2026, this market will resolve to “Other.”
This market will resolve in favor of the constructor team that is officially recognized by Formula 1 as having set the fastest time during the qualifying session for the 2026 F1 Italian Grand Prix. The market will be settled based on the FIA's official qualifying results, regardless of any subsequent penalties, disqualifications, or changes to the starting grid.
For example, if a constructor team sets the fastest qualifying time but later receives a grid penalty or is moved down the starting order, the market will still resolve to “Yes” for that constructor team.
The resolution source will be the official Formula 1 website and a consensus of credible sports news reporting.
